Output f177af63378931ae797e714b7c4f24dc300fb98de7cec71103b87721d7f9487c:0

value
32841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001d9f2ec499cb75d3f3f35444d086e9e708d79e OP_EQUAL
address
31hdQhjBjjwxKSbwfwrEkpmsmVeJz7HaZx
transaction
f177af63378931ae797e714b7c4f24dc300fb98de7cec71103b87721d7f9487c
spent
true